Web5 jun. 2024 · Previous studies found significant taste loss 4–5 weeks after starting RT treatments [ 1, 2, 3, 7 ], but the recovery rate is still controversial. Some studies reported that most patients recover 1–4 months after RT [ 15, 17, 21 ], while others showed incomplete or no recovery even several years later [ 6, 7, 8 ]. WebTaste changes caused by radiation treatment usually start to improve 3 weeks to 2 months after treatment ends. Taste changes may continue to improve for about a year.
